The retreat takes place at Le Terre di Zoè, an organic farmhouse in southern Calabria run by Niramaya Yoga. The property is set among citrus groves, with gardens and a spring-water pool. It's a rural setting, quiet and surrounded by nature, with the beach at Nicotera Marina about a short drive away. The rooms are simple but comfortable, with air conditioning and private bathrooms.
Each day starts with a yoga practice, usually a mix of asana, pranayama, and meditation. The style is influenced by Hatha and Ashtanga yoga, taught by Subit, who is an internationally certified Ashtanga teacher, and Dorothea, who is a certified yoga therapist and physiotherapist. They focus on proper alignment and adapt the practice to what you need that day. Since the group is small, you'll get personal attention.
The afternoons are for exploring or relaxing. Three half-day excursions are included: visits to a historic village like Nicotera, coastal viewpoints, and maybe some beach time. There's also an Ayurveda cooking class where you learn to make simple, healthy dishes using local ingredients. The rest of the time, you can read by the pool, walk through the groves, or book an optional massage.
The retreat ends with a closing satsang and gratitude circle on the last evening, then a final breakfast before departure. The pace is unhurried, and the focus is on rest and reconnecting – not on pushing your limits. The hosts are welcoming and make sure you feel looked after from the moment you arrive with a welcome tea and orientation.
